
RW 2000 C is the ultimate backhaul solution for IP & TDM Networks.
Reaching 200 Mbps aggregate throughput and providing IP and TDM over same link make this product this product ideal for today’s and tomorrow’s networks, preparing operators for the seamless migration from legacy TDM to all-IP networks such as LTE/4G.
RW 2000 C-Series products operate in symmetric mode as well as in adaptive asymmetric mode, whereby capacity is dynamically allocated between uplink and downlink based on traffic loads and air-interface conditions. Extremely simple to install and maintain, systems operate flawlessly in the most challenging environments, including non-line-of-site scenarios, interference-ridden environments and extreme temperatures.
Highlights
• 200 Mbps net aggregate throughput
• Native TDM (Up to 16 E1s/T1s) + Ethernet over the same link
• Single radio supporting multiple bands (2.4 and 4.9 – 5.9 GHz)
• Long range - up to 120 Km/75 miles
• Adaptive asymmetric capacity – dynamic allocation of uplink & downlink traffic, enabling more capacity at longer ranges
• Advanced MIMO, OFDM and Diversity technologies
RW 2000 PDH Series
RW 2000 PDH is the industry’s first Sub 6-GHz Microwave PDH System delivering up to 16 E1s/T1s + 10 Mbps Ethernet. Designed to address carriers’ cellular backhaul requirements, RW 2000 PDH provides high-end performance, capacity and range never before seen in its price category.
Highlights
• Up to 16 E1s/T1s + 10 Mbps Ethernet
• Native TDM transport
• Multi-band radio supports multiple bands on one platform (2.4 and 4.9 – 6 GHz)
• Advanced radio technologies inside: OFDM, MIMO an Diversity
• High Availability & Reliability
• 1+1 Monitored Hot Standby support
• Advanced MIMO, OFDM and Diversity technologies
• Most competitive price in the industry
RW 2000 L-Series
RW 2000 provides up to 50 Mbps symmetric throughput and a flexible combination of native TDM (up to 16 E1s/T1s) and Ethernet, enabling operators to cost-effectively support converged IP + TDM networks.
The RW 2000 L-Series radios fit a broad range of Cellular & IP backhaul applications, broadband connectivity to large corporates and high capacity for private networks. They offer a compelling price/performance ratio that is unprecedented in the industry.
Highlights
• Up to 50 Mbps symmetric throughput and up to 16 E1s/T1s
• Native TDM transport
• Long range - up to 120 Km/75 miles
• Single radio supporting multiple bands (2.4 and 4.8 – 6 GHz)
• Advanced MIMO, OFDM and Diversity technologies
• Built-in mechanisms to mitigate interference
• 1+1 backup support
